Quarterly Planning Note — Large-Deal Discount Policy

Quick update for the board: big-ticket discounting got a bit loose last quarter. Three deals above the Merrivale threshold went out with discounts over 22%, which squeezed margin on the Quellan Suite more than we'd like. Proposal: cap standard discounts at 15%, with anything higher needing sign-off from Tomas Reinfeld's pricing council. Sales says this won't scare off the Ardenport prospects, and we mostly believe them. One sensitive item on forward strategy is appended below.

management briefing: Project Ulavan slips by two quarters because of the staffing delay.

Meeting notes (excerpt) — Torvale platform sync. We walked through how the Quillgate API nodes sit behind the Larkspur load balancer. Health checks hit /healthz every 10 seconds; two consecutive failures pull a node from rotation, and recovery requires three passes. Important for the new contractor: never mark a node healthy manually without checking the drain queue first. Any changes to check intervals must be approved by the engineer named below.

account owner for bawip-tahag: Raleth Quenok

The Inkmill pipeline turns raw markdown from Draftern into rendered HTML for the Loomfield docs site. Three stages: sanitize, render, cache. If pages come out mangled, it's almost always the sanitizer choking on custom shortcodes — check its logs first. Restarting the render workers is safe anytime; the cache rebuilds itself. Never restart the sanitizer mid-batch, though, or you'll get half-cleaned output. Step-by-step recovery instructions live on the internal page here.

wiki page, tahaf-tajog: https://jira.ordindyn.corp/pipeline

// Fixture: waveform preview render tests for the Soundline player.
// Covers peak downsampling, mono fold-down, and zero-length clips.
// Uses canned PCM blobs from fixtures/audio; do not regenerate locally.
// The preview service at Glimmerfon staging validates each request,
// so tests hit the live stub. Requests authenticate with the bearer token below.

login token, bagug-kafop: eyJhbGciOiJIUzI1NiIsInR5cCI6IkpXVCJ9.eyJzdWIiOiIcMLov2In0.Z5RLDIfp